AI Technical Summary
Existing EML TO-CAN components suffer from low spectral performance and focal length testing efficiency, especially due to the bottleneck in testing efficiency caused by two fiber couplings.
The focal length and spectral measurements are combined into one, using multimode fiber for single coupling, and the test is performed by combining an altitude probe and a spectrometer to calculate the focal length and spectral data.
This greatly improved testing efficiency, shortened testing time, increased production capacity, and achieved cost reduction and efficiency improvement.
